PIA26350: JunoCam Captures Jupiter on 62nd Flyby

This view of Jupiter was captured by the JunoCam instrument aboard NASAs Juno spacecraft during the missions 62nd close flyby of the giant planet on June 13, 2024. Citizen scientist Jackie Branc made the image using raw JunoCam data.
